What are the responsibilities and job description for the Maintenance Technician position at Midwestern Pet Foods, Inc?

Shift Available: Sunday night/Monday morning to Thursday night/Friday morning from 11pm to 7:30am

The Maintenance Technician is responsible for assessing mechanical, technical, and electrical problems in all areas of the facility. This position requires a highly motivated, self-directed multi crafted worker that can work autonomously in a fast-paced production environment. The individual will be responsible for the timely repair and preventative maintenance of plant equipment. Including mixing and extruding systems, packaging machines, metal detectors, sealers, motors, pumps and conveying equipment. Technicians must follow all established safety, Food Safety/GMP`s and environmental standards and adhere to all plant technical standards.

Requirements

  • High school Diploma, GED
  • 2-year Technical Trade school certification, military applicable certifications, vocational training, and/or Journeyman License preferred.
  • 2-5 years of experience in a manufacturing environment operating, repairing and/or troubleshooting issues on tangible equipment such as Pumps, Mechanical Drives, Lubrication, Fasteners, Piping, Proper Tool Use, Motors, Pneumatics, Sensors, Proximity Switches, Automatic Valves and other basic mechanical systems and processes.
  • Previous food industry experience is a plus.
  • Practical operation of power tools and maintenance shop equipment.
  • Ability to read mechanical and electrical drawings and schematics.
  • Able to use Technical Manuals and precision measurement tools.
  • Work with work orders and web-based computer applications.
  • Must be able to work on your feet for up to 12 Hours.
  • Must be able to lift, push or pull up to 60 pounds.
  • Must be able to climb ladders, work at heights, work overhead, work in confined spaces and work in very hot and very cool environments.
  • While performing the duties of this job, the technician is regularly required to talk and listen/hear. This position is very active and requires standing, walking, bending, kneeling, stooping, crouching, crawling, and climbing all day.
